Transaction 644f908ac38b68634d1324e0d51eddfb37c83ea069c492fa14650b48c9510781
1 Input
1 Output
-
644f908ac38b68634d1324e0d51eddfb37c83ea069c492fa14650b48c9510781:0
- value
- 2166485700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e09c7861e581a669700ea5433779c9a5c18a3e60 OP_EQUAL
- address
- 3NAejFrTyo4HSizzFu97LwmPmL1PqtykEC